The Best Carbendazim Pesticides A Comprehensive Guide


Carbendazim is a widely used fungicide renowned for its efficacy against a variety of fungal pathogens affecting crops. With increasing global agricultural demands, farmers are in search of effective solutions to protect their crops from diseases, making carbendazim a popular choice in plant protection. This article explores the benefits, application, and considerations involved in using the best carbendazim pesticides.


Understanding Carbendazim


Carbendazim belongs to the benzimidazole class of fungicides and is primarily used to control powdery mildew, rusts, and other diseases in a wide range of crops, including fruits, vegetables, and ornamental plants. It works by inhibiting cell division in fungi, which ultimately leads to their death. Its systemic properties allow it to be absorbed by plants, providing overall protection as well as treatment for existing infections.


Advantages of Using Carbendazim


One of the main advantages of carbendazim is its broad-spectrum effectiveness. It acts against a variety of fungal species, making it versatile for use across different crops. Furthermore, carbendazim has a relatively low toxicity to non-target organisms, making it a safer option when compared to some other fungicides available in the market.


Moreover, carbendazim offers long-lasting protection. While some fungicides require frequent applications, carbendazim can remain effective for an extended period, which is beneficial for farmers looking to minimize labor and application costs. This prolonged action is especially advantageous during the growth period of crops, where prolonged disease pressure may occur.

Application of Carbendazim


When using carbendazim, it is crucial to follow the manufacturer's guidelines regarding dosage and application frequency. Generally, it can be applied as a foliar spray or as a soil treatment, depending on the target fungal disease. For optimal results, applications should be made during periods when conditions are favorable for disease development, such as high humidity or prolonged wetness.


Farmers should also be aware of the recommended pre-harvest interval (PHI) for carbendazim to ensure food safety. This interval varies depending on the crop and the specific formulation of the product used. It is important to adhere to these guidelines to avoid residues on harvested produce.


Considerations and Resistance Management


While carbendazim is effective, over-reliance on a single fungicide can lead to the development of resistant fungal strains. To mitigate this risk, it is advisable to employ an integrated pest management (IPM) approach, combining chemical controls with cultural practices and biological controls. Rotating fungicides with different modes of action can significantly reduce the risk of resistance.


In conclusion, carbendazim remains one of the best choices for managing fungal diseases in crops. Its effectiveness, safety profile, and longevity make it a valuable tool for farmers. However, responsible usage and adherence to best management practices are essential to ensure its efficacy and sustainability in agricultural production. As we move towards more sustainable farming practices, integrating carbendazim with IPM will be key to protecting crops and boosting agricultural productivity in the future.
